The market will always disappoint. A card in an auction type setting will sell for as low as possible. You have two
things going for you, obviously the card is a #1 of, which people collect, not only set builders but Dalton collectors.
The second thing going for you is a nice patch.

List it with a high BIN and then take offers. It might be worth 200 bucks to someone, but if they only have to pay
100 to get it, then they will. If you take offers then they have to come strong with offers. You should be able to see
what other cards of its kind go for and gauge from there. I'm guessing 10-20% premium or more on it. Good Luck!

I typically use the .99 and let it ride format, but after doing a little digging I think I'll go the BIN/BO option instead.
I checked ending prices on the Murray and auction formats tended to end around 30-35 dollars where as the BIN/BO's were being hit anywhere from $80 to over $100.
Pretty crazy.
